Warsaw, July 8,
A communique admits that General Budienny's cavalary, attack- ing from the west, occupied Revuo and compelled the Poles to re treat. Heavy fighting occurred in all sectors in Polesia later.
The communique says that between the Dvina and the Upper Bersina the Poles retired in the face of superiar-numbers of the enemy, who also crossed the Beresina in force southeast of Barysa
A Polish counter-action is developing favourably. In view of the military position, offers to serve with the colours are pouring in from all classes-University professors to the boy
scouts.

AMERICAN TRADE WITH RUSSIL
Washington, July 3. -
The State Department has removed the restrictions on trade with Soviet Russia except ia connection with the shipment of material suitable for immediate use for war parpases.
AMERICA BLYS SILVER
New York. July 3 The Treasury has purchased 235,000 ounces of silver at a dollar per ounce.
